Where do most divergent boundaries originate?

Most divergent boundaries originate WITHIN CONTINENTS.
Divergent boundaries refers to a linear structure that is present in between a pair of tectonic plates that are moving away from each other. Divergent boundaries originate from within continents and they usually produce rifts which later become rift valleys.

Fluid filled sacs in the knee are specifically called
antoniya [11.8K]
Fluid filled sacs in the knee are specifically called Bursa or Bursae. Bursae is plural for Bursa.
A bursa is a closed fluid filled sac that function as a gliding surface to reduce friction between tissues of the body. Knee bursitis occurs when there is irritation or inflammation in one one of the knee bursa. The procedure of removing fluid-filled sac is called bursectomy. When the bursa become infected with bacteria, this condition is called septic bursitis.

In most cases, the two major climatic factors affecting the distribution of organisms in terrestrial ecosystems are __________.
sesenic [268]

Answer:

precipitation and temperature

Explanation:

Temperature and water are considered major abiotic factors that affect species distribution in terrestrial ecosystems. The temperature can affect the distribution of terrestrial organisms due to many species maintain a constant internal temperature, while other species maintain a body temperature range that may be very different from the environmental temperature, and therefore they will not be able to carry out their metabolic functions. Hibernation is an adaptation that allows some terrestrial animals to escape temperature fluctuations. Moreover, water is another limiting factor for life, since water is critical for cellular processes. The waxy cuticle is an adaptation that allows terrestrial plants to avoid excessive water loss through transpiration.
